Details
A vulnerability classified as critical has been found in WWBN AVideo 11.6. This affects the function aVideoEncoder
of the component HTTP Request Handler. The manipulation with an unknown input leads to a os command injection vulnerability. CWE is classifying the issue as CWE-78. The product constructs all or part of an OS command using externally-influenced input from an upstream component, but it does not neutralize or incorrectly neutralizes special elements that could modify the intended OS command when it is sent to a downstream component.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:
An os command injection vulnerability exists in the aVideoEncoder wget functionality of WWBN AVideo 11.6 and dev master commit 3f7c0364. A specially-crafted HTTP request can lead to arbitrary command execution. An attacker can send an HTTP request to trigger this vulnerability.
The weakness was published 08/23/2022 as TALOS-2022-1548. It is possible to read the advisory at talosintelligence.com. This vulnerability is uniquely identified as CVE-2022-32572 since 06/13/2022. Technical details of the vulnerability are known, but there is no available exploit. The attack technique deployed by this issue is T1202 according to MITRE ATT&CK.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
